Let's represent the unknown number with the variable x.
Then " twice a number" would be written as : 2x
Next, "twice a number less 3" would be written as: 2x - 3
The text, "equal 19" can be written as: = 19
Combining these expressions gives us: 2x - 3 = 19
You can solve this equation for the unknown number using inverse operations:
2x - 3 = 19
2x - 3 + 3 = 19 + 3
2x = 22
2x/2 = 22/2
x =11
The unknown number would be 11 .
